We can drag and drop to rearrange tasks.includes some keyboard shortcuts to work with the program.Will allow us defer tasks to the next few days or to a custom date.These are tasks that don't have a start date set in the future, don't have dependencies/subtasks blocking them, and aren't tagged with a tag set to be excluded from the work view. Includes a 'actionable' task view mode.Allows add detailed notes and descriptions within a task, if required.It will also allow us to create infinite subtasks.We can quickly create multiple subtasks using * or – as if they were bulleted lists.As well we can use keywords like 'date:', and it detects anywhere in the title or description.Supports dates like 'today', 'tomorrow', 'thursday', '14', 'now' and the ISO 8601 standard, anywhere in the user interface.The program will also have natural language parsing capabilities and a free-form task text editor.Here we will find a customization capacity similar to labels. We will have the possibility of search and save.Labels can be hierarchical or not, they can have an assigned color and/or an emblem icon.
